mooore pigs

This commit is contained in:
elisejakob
2024-05-13 00:13:54 +02:00
parent 794818db13
commit fa4ec12a04
13 changed files with 596 additions and 5 deletions

View File

@ -27,7 +27,7 @@ export const EventHeader = ({ event }: { event: EventFragment }) => {
/> />
)} )}
<div className={styles.pig}> <div className={styles.pig}>
<Pig type="logo" /> <Pig type="student" />
</div> </div>
</div> </div>
</div> </div>

View File

@ -26,7 +26,12 @@
.pig { .pig {
position: absolute; position: absolute;
bottom: -30%; bottom: 0;
right: -2.5rem; right: -2.5rem;
transform: translateY(50%);
color: var(--color-white); color: var(--color-white);
>div {
width: 30vw;
}
} }

View File

@ -1,5 +1,15 @@
import styles from "./pig.module.scss"; import styles from "./pig.module.scss";
import { ChillPig } from "./pigs/ChillPig";
import { DancePig } from "./pigs/DancePig";
import { DrinkPig } from "./pigs/DrinkPig";
import { GuardPig } from "./pigs/GuardPig";
import { KeyPig } from "./pigs/KeyPig";
import { ListenPig } from "./pigs/ListenPig";
import { LogoPig } from "./pigs/LogoPig"; import { LogoPig } from "./pigs/LogoPig";
import { MusicPig } from "./pigs/MusicPig";
import { PeekPig } from "./pigs/PeekPig";
import { PointPig } from "./pigs/PointPig";
import { StudentPig } from "./pigs/StudentPig";
export const Pig = ({ export const Pig = ({
type, type,
@ -7,13 +17,29 @@ export const Pig = ({
type: type:
| "logo" | "logo"
| "music" | "music"
| "drink"
| "dance"
| "point" | "point"
| "student" | "student"
| "dance"
| "listen" | "listen"
| "drink"
| "guard" | "guard"
| "key"
| "chill"
| "peek"; | "peek";
}) => { }) => {
return <div className={styles.pig}>{type === "logo" && <LogoPig />}</div>; return (
<div className={styles.pig}>
{type === "logo" && <LogoPig />}
{type === "music" && <MusicPig />}
{type === "drink" && <DrinkPig />}
{type === "dance" && <DancePig />}
{type === "point" && <PointPig />}
{type === "student" && <StudentPig />}
{type === "listen" && <ListenPig />}
{type === "guard" && <GuardPig />}
{type === "key" && <KeyPig />}
{type === "chill" && <ChillPig />}
{type === "peek" && <PeekPig />}
</div>
);
}; };

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long